Seedot (タネボー) is the 22nd Pokémon in the Hoenn Pokédex. It is a Grass Type, and is classified as the Acorn Pokémon.
Seedot can have one of three abilities: Chlorophyll, which doubles its Speed when it is sunny, but not on the same turn in which the weather becomes sunny; or Early Bird, which cuts the number of turns afflicted with the Sleep condition in half, rounded down to the nearest full number. Seedot from the Dream World have the Pickpocket Ability. This ability allows the Pokémon to steal the opponent's held item when the opponent uses an attack that requires physical contact against it.
Seedot gain the opportunity to evolve into Nuzleaf starting at Level 14. It can then evolve into a Shiftry when a Leaf Stone is used on it.
Seedot is in the Egg Groups Field and Grass, and its Egg takes approximately 3,840 Steps to hatch. It takes Seedot 1,059,860 Experience Points to reach Level 100.

[edit] Biology
[edit] Physiology
Seedot takes the appearance of an acorn that has two eyes and feet.
[edit] Gender Differences
Seedot doesn't have any distinguishable characteristics to differentiate between male and female.
[edit] Game Information
[edit] Original Games
Seedot appears at Routes 102 and 114 in Ruby, and Routes 102, 117, and 120 in Emerald. Seedot does not appear in the wild in Sapphire.
Seedot appears at Route 203, Route 204, the South end of Route 210 and the Eterna Forest in Diamond, Pearl, and Platinum with Pokémon Ruby inserted into the Game Boy Advance slot of your Nintendo DS.
Seedot appears at White Forest in Pokémon White. In Black 2 and White 2, a Seedot can be obtained by Breeding one of its evolved forms.
[edit] Spin-off Games
Seedot appears as a Shadow Pokémon in Pokémon XD: Gale of Darkness. Snag it from Cipher Peon Greesix at the Cipher Lab to obtain it.
Seedot appears at Secret Storage 13, Endless Level 28 and Mr. Who's Den in Pokémon Trozei!.
Seedot appears at Uproar Forest 1F-9F and Southern Cavern 1F-9F in the first Mystery Dungeon games. In Explorers of Time, Explorers of Darkness and Explorers of Sky, Seedot appears at Mystery Jungle B1-B29. In Explorers of Time & Darkness, Seedot appears at Mystifying Forest B1-B13 and at Happy Outlook B1-B19; in Explorers of Sky Seedot appears at Mystic Forest B1-B13 and Joy Cape B1-B19. Seedot is exclusive to Stormy Adventure Squad in Mystery Dungeon 3, appearing at Cloudy Rockland B1-B15.
Seedot appears at the Cycla Mountain Range in Pokémon Ranger. Seedot appears on the Chicole Path in Pokémon Ranger: Shadows of Almia, but the Field Assist Slam 1 needs to be used on a Tree to draw it out of hiding. Seedot does not appear in Pokémon Ranger: Guardian Signs.
Seedot can be found at Firebreathing Mountain Autumnwood in Pokémon Rumble Blast.
[edit] Trading Card Game
Seedot appears in ten different sets. It is listed as a Common Card in the following sets: EX Sandstorm (2), EX Hidden Legends, EX Deoxys, EX Legend Maker, EX Crystal Guardians, EX Power Keepers, Diamond and Pearl, Rising Rivals and Next Destinies.
[edit] Anime/Manga Information
[edit] Anime
Wild Seedot have the majority of its appearances in the Anime, although other trainers have been seen using a Seedot in the episodes Pinch Healing! and Old Rivals, New Tricks.
[edit] Movies
Wild Seedot appear in the films Destiny Deoxys and Giratina and the Sky Warrior.

| III | Pokémon Ruby | Seedot attaches itself to a tree branch using the top of its head. It sucks moisture from the tree while hanging off the branch. The more water it drinks, the glossier this Pokémon's body becomes. |
| III | Pokémon Sapphire | Seedot looks exactly like an acorn when it is dangling from a tree branch. It startles other Pokémon by suddenly moving. This Pokémon polishes its body once a day using leaves. |
| III | Pokémon Emerald | It hangs off branches and absorbs nutrients. When it finishes eating, its body becomes so heavy that it drops to the ground with a thump. |
| III | Pokémon FireRed | If it remains still, it becomes impossible to distinguish from real nuts. It delights in surprising foraging Pidgey. |
| III | Pokémon LeafGreen | If it remains still, it becomes impossible to distinguish from real nuts. It delights in surprising foraging Pidgey. |
| IV | Pokémon Diamond | When it dangles from a tree branch, it looks just like an acorn. It enjoys scaring other Pokémon. |
| IV | Pokémon Pearl | When it dangles from a tree branch, it looks just like an acorn. It enjoys scaring other Pokémon. |
| IV | Pokémon Platinum | When it dangles from a tree branch, it looks just like an acorn. It enjoys scaring other Pokémon. |
| IV | Pokémon HeartGold | It attaches itself to a tree branch using the top of its head. Strong winds can sometimes make it fall. |
| IV | Pokémon SoulSilver | It attaches itself to a tree branch using the top of its head. Strong winds can sometimes make it fall. |
